Chaotic Madrid Derby Ends in Dramatic 1-1 Draw

The Madrid derby, one of the most anticipated fixtures in European football, once again proved its unpredictability and high drama. Atletico Madrid and Real Madrid played out a chaotic 1-1 draw at the Wanda Metropolitano, but this was no ordinary stalemate. Filled with tension, fan outbursts, and a late twist, this edition of the Madrid derby kept viewers on the edge of their seats, despite a lackluster start. A Dull Start to a Promising Derby

The Madrid derby has a reputation for being fierce and action-packed, with a long history of dramatic moments between the two rivals. However, the opening hour of this encounter left many fans frustrated, with both Atletico and Real opting for a cautious approach. Defensive solidity seemed to be the priority for both sides, with very few chances being created, and the game was dominated by physical battles rather than moments of attacking brilliance.

Real Madrid, under Carlo Ancelotti, appeared content to soak up pressure and wait for Atletico to make a mistake, while Diego Simeone’s men seemed determined to prevent Real from capitalizing on any space. Unfortunately, this led to a stale first half, with both sets of fans growing increasingly restless as they awaited a spark to ignite the match.

By the 60th minute, the game had featured few clear chances, and the tension in the stadium was palpable. Atletico’s fans were growing frustrated, especially as their team failed to create any meaningful opportunities. Meanwhile, Real Madrid’s supporters, many of whom had traveled across the city for this derby, were eager for their team to show the attacking flair that has made them European giants.

Militao Breaks the Deadlock and Chaos Erupts

Thankfully for the neutrals, the stalemate was finally broken in the 65th minute, when Eder Militao scored a fantastic volley to give Real Madrid the lead. The Brazilian center-back, known more for his defensive contributions, found himself in the perfect position after Vinicius Junior delivered a perfectly-placed cross from the left flank. Militao’s technique was flawless, smashing the ball below the crossbar and giving Jan Oblak no chance in the Atletico goal.

The eruption of joy among Real Madrid fans was matched by despair and frustration from the Atletico faithful. The goal was a rare moment of quality in what had been a largely uneventful game, and it seemed as though Real Madrid would walk away with three points.

However, the mood in the stadium quickly turned sour. Atletico’s fans, angered by the goal and their team’s lackluster performance, began throwing objects onto the pitch. Cigarette lighters, plastic bottles, and other debris were hurled in the direction of Real Madrid’s players, particularly targeting goalkeeper Thibaut Courtois, who had once played for Atletico Madrid.

The referee had no choice but to temporarily suspend the match, sending both teams to the locker rooms for a cooling-off period. The suspension lasted for 15 minutes, during which the tension inside the stadium only grew. Security personnel worked hard to clear the debris from the pitch, while both managers urged their players to stay focused.

The Resumption of Play and Atletico’s Response

When the players finally returned to the pitch, it was clear that Atletico Madrid were eager to claw their way back into the game. Simeone made tactical adjustments, pushing his team forward in search of an equalizer. The intensity of the match increased, with both sides playing with more urgency.

Atletico’s best chance to equalize came shortly after play resumed, when Samuel Lino, one of the standout performers for Los Colchoneros, weaved his way past Dani Carvajal and Militao with some brilliant dribbling. Lino unleashed a powerful shot from inside the box, but Courtois, showing why he is regarded as one of the world’s best goalkeepers, managed to tip the ball over the crossbar with a last-gasp effort.

Real Madrid responded to Atletico’s pressure by launching quick counterattacks, and one of their brightest young talents, Endrick, came close to doubling the lead. The 18-year-old Brazilian picked up the ball in his own half and embarked on a 30-yard solo run, outpacing Atletico defender Le Normand. However, Endrick’s low shot lacked the precision needed to beat Oblak, and it drifted just wide of the post.

Correa’s Late Equalizer and VAR Drama

As the game entered its final stages, Atletico Madrid continued to push for a goal, but Real Madrid’s defense held firm. It seemed as though Ancelotti’s men would hold on for a hard-fought victory, but the real drama was yet to come.

With eight minutes of stoppage time added, Atletico had one last chance to salvage a point. Two minutes into stoppage time, Angel Correa found himself in a dangerous position, having managed to evade Real Madrid’s offside trap. The Argentine forward rounded Courtois and Militao, slotting the ball into the net for what appeared to be a dramatic equalizer.

Initially, the linesman raised his flag for offside, and the goal was disallowed, much to the dismay of the Atletico fans. However, after a lengthy VAR review, the decision was overturned, and the goal stood. The Wanda Metropolitano erupted in celebration, as Atletico had secured a last-gasp equalizer in one of the most chaotic Madrid derbies in recent memory.
